Output 95df60656a87383ee22dc3e5cb1f55e28d6872e203a94d36781a3be0105cd8d2:1

value
2096940
script pubkey
OP_0 OP_PUSHBYTES_20 d4d7fe77e29f044d306f49656844cbe558b693a5
address
ltc1q6ntlualznuzy6vr0f9jks3xtu4vtdya9pq5jzx
transaction
95df60656a87383ee22dc3e5cb1f55e28d6872e203a94d36781a3be0105cd8d2
spent
true